Henrique Rocha and Daniel Merida Aguilar meet in the Perugia Challenger final on clay, with the higher-ranked Spaniard Merida Aguilar (No. 86) facing the Portuguese Rocha (No. 119). Both players advanced convincingly through the draw, as Rocha posted straight-set semifinal and quarterfinal wins while Merida Aguilar overcame a three-set semifinal test. Rocha holds a 2-0 head-to-head edge from prior encounters, though recent form and ranking favor Merida Aguilar on the slower surface. Key variables include fatigue from the long tournament week, clay-court movement efficiency, and any late adjustments to playing styles in this title match.
